  • ViX 2.4 is superbly stable more so than 2.3 ever was although for me 2.3 was also exceptionally stable.


    if you look on the OpenViX site you will see a icon to show the status of the current Build green for stable, red for unstable and gold for updates being uploaded to the server.


    now as to the regular updates you see, we dont just put them there for the sake of it, if you read the changelog i upload with every build you will see just what we have changed in that build, but as always make a set of backups if your unsure so that you can return to a working image if the worst happens.


    as for ViX 2.3 i see your still uploading crashlogs on a almost daily basis and we do appreciate that but We no longer update nor maintain ViX 2.3 so there will be no updates for that image, i will say though if you move to ViX 2.4 you will find that almost all if not all your problems are resolved in this newer image.

  • look here for the icon.


    as for logs crashlogs are usually enough although we will sometimes ask for debug logs as well, try setting the backup location to the HDD see if it works then, if yes you can always FTP into the image and copy the backups to your pc for later use.
